Media Officer of the council, Mr Babajide Dada, gave the warning in an interview with the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) on Tuesday.
The
Oshodi-Isolo Local Government Authority on Wednesday gave residents 48 hours to
remove all abandoned vehicles on the roads or the vehicles would be impounded.
Dada said
that failure to remove such vehicles would attract sanctions.
“The removal
of abandoned vehicles becomes necessary to bring sanity on our roads and for
adequate security. Many of these abandoned vehicles are used as a hideout to
perpetrate various degrees of nefarious activities within the community.
“The council
authority in a stern warning implored those whose abandoned vehicles with the
warning stickers from the Local Government to please remove those vehicles
within the next 48 hours or incur the wrath of the law,” he said.
The men of
the traffic section, he said have visited Sehinde Calisto, Apapa Oshodi Exp.
Way, Odunmaku, Aduke Thomas, Yusuf, Olaiya, Makinde streets.
